    Why does THF have enmity stealing JA, and PLD does not?

    Why does THF have enmity stealing JA (Collab/Accomp), and PLD does not? Thieves steal items, not hate - stealing hate on THF just sounds ridiculous.

    Having the ability to sneak-ily move hate onto other players (i.e. Trick Attack) makes sense for thief - sly, tactical, and misleading - however, stealing hate from another player from the simple use of a JA is just strange, it always has been. I realize this isn't a new JA, it's just something I've been meaning to post for a while.

    A PLD might say, "hey there Monster, stop picking on my WHM friend and try some one your own size!" and provoke the monster to his attention - but would a THF? I'd say no... it just doesn't fit the picture. The THF might throw a rock and distract the monster temporarily as he ran off into the forest - but I don't think this "valiant" ability for a thief to 'steal' enmity, and sacrafice himself to save the whm makes any sense at all. A THF should be more selfish than that (at least by character description).

    Using Google Translator on this JP thread from a community rep shows the following,"

    When using cover, I want you to move enmity from the player who received cover to the PLD
    As the ability of a similar effect, the "deceptive attack" is already available to Thief (Collab/Accomp). Thief is where you want to transfer it to the fighting.
    So SE's response to a long list of questions about giving the PLD enmity control, was basically to say - if you want to hold hate, that's the job for THF. Wow... just wow.

    This is just very wrong and very frustrating. Is there no creative director at FFXI ? Is there no hope for lore and logic anymore? Please SE, please respond to this...
